Concept:The cosine function cosθ has a range from −1 to 1.Multiplying by a positive constant scales this range linearly.Explanation:Let f(A)=3cos(A+3π), where A∈R.For any real angle θ, we know −1≤cosθ≤1.Here θ=A+3π takes all real values as A varies.Thus −1≤cos(A+3π)≤1.Multiply the entire inequality by 3 (positive, so direction unchanged):−3≤3cos(A+3π)≤3.Hence the minimum value of f(A) is the lower bound −3.Answer:−3 (Option A)
